 According to docx in
 https://wiki.osgeo.org/wiki/SAC_Service_Status#Download one should be able
 to login to the download container by just being in the posixShell gruop
 and having keys published in LDAP. This is NOT the case, at the moment.

 If it ever worked, it broke. It *might* (or might not) be due to the way I
 changed storage of ssh keys in LDAP with the work in #2542.

 Initial setup of this LDAP/SSH connection was done by Regina in #2116

 Other machines where this should work, according to
 https://trac.osgeo.org/osgeo/ticket/2116#comment:3 are:

   - hop.osgeo3.osgeo.org
   - hop.osgeo4.osgeo.org
   - hop.osgeo7.osgeo.org

 None are working for me, when I mv ~/.ssh away
